DMX Series High Pulse Energy Nanosecond Lasers

Specifications

Avg. Power: 30 W
Wavelength: 532 nm
Repetition Rate: 0.001 – 10 kHz
Spatial Mode (M^2): 10
Pulse Duration: 100 ns
Pulse-to-Pulse Stability (RMS): 0.5 %
Cooling: Water-to-Water, Water-to-Air
Pulse Energy: 20-100 mJ

Features


  • Patented Highest Pulse Energy Green Laser: Achieve superior performance with the highest pulse energy at 527 nm.

  • Compact Form Factor: Consolidated controls within the laser head for ultimate ease-of-use operability via GUI software.

  • Ideal Power Supply: Designed for 19” rack-mount configurations with an optional flange kit available.

  • Monolithic Laser Head: Simplest, high-performance design with the driver contained in the laser head for maximum efficiency.

  • Optimized for PIV and Ti:Sapphire Amplifiers: Perfect for pumping Ti:Sapphire laser amplifiers and Particle Image Velocimetry applications.

  • Pulse Energy Up to 100 mJ: Delivers high pulse energy for demanding applications.

  • Proprietary Twin Pulse Option: Offers double pulses from a single trigger signal with user-programmable energy ratio and pulse separation.

  • Dual Head Option Available: Includes GUI software adjustable turning mirrors, eliminating the need for manual adjustment.

  • Uniform Beam Profile: Ensures consistent and reliable performance.

  • Excellent Pulse to Pulse Stability: Achieves ~0.5% RMS stability for precision applications.


 

Applications


  • Particle Image Velocimetry (PIV): Ideal for capturing high-speed fluid dynamics.

  • Annealing or “Bleaching”: Change material properties without material removal.

  • Pumping Ti:Sa Ultrafast Amplifier Systems: Enhance ultrafast laser systems with high power.

  • High Power or High Pulse Energy Drilling or Cutting: Suitable for hard materials.
